Introduktion till Next.js: Fördelar, funktioner och Komma igång

I den snabbt utvecklande världen av webbutveckling har att bygga webbapplikationer blivit en integrerad del av många områden. Varje dag dyker ny teknik upp som ger oss kraftfullare verktyg och ramverk som sparar tid och förbättrar prestandan. I den här artikeln tar vi oss tid att utforska, Next.js en teknik som har fått allt större uppmärksamhet från utvecklingsgemenskapen.

Vad är Next.js ?

Next.js, en framework utvecklad av Vercel, är en anmärkningsvärd blandning av React och server-side rendering(SSR) kapacitet. Detta innebär att Next.js du kan bygga React applikationer som renderar på servern, optimerar prestanda och förbättrar SEO. Du kan utnyttja React funktioner, men med optimeringsfördelarna med SSR, vilket gör att din webbplats laddas snabbare och visar innehåll bättre på sökmotorer.

Varför ska du använda Next.js ?

  1. Förbättrad prestanda: Med rendering på serversidan kommer din webbplats att laddas snabbare, vilket ger en bättre användarupplevelse och förbättrar SEO genom att visa innehåll bättre på sökmotorer.

  2. Naturligt Routing: Next.js ger ett smidigt routing system, vilket gör det enkelt att hantera sökvägar och sidor.

  3. SEO-optimering: Eftersom webbplatsen är förrenderad på servern kan sökmotorer som Google bättre förstå ditt innehåll och förbättra SEO-rankingen.

  4. Enkel datahämtning: Next.js erbjuder metoder som gör det enkelt att hämta data från olika källor, från statisk till dynamisk.

  5. Smidig utveckling: Genom att kombinera React och SSR blir utvecklingsprocessen enklare och mer effektiv.

Ställa in utvecklingsmiljön

Innan du går in i Next.js, är det viktigt att se till att din utvecklingsmiljö är korrekt inställd. Vi börjar med de mest grundläggande stegen så att du kan ge dig ut på din resa för att utveckla spännande webbapplikationer.

Steg 1: Installera Node.js och npm(eller garn)

För det första måste vi installera Node.js- JavaScript runtime-miljön- tillsammans med npm(Node Package Manager) eller Yarn hantera beroenden. Du kan ladda ner och installera Node.js från den officiella Node.js webbplatsen. Efter installationen kan du kontrollera versionerna av Node.js och npm genom att köra följande kommandon i kommandoradsfönstret:

node -v  
npm -v  

Steg 2: Skapa ett enkelt Next.js projekt

Låt oss nu skapa ett enkelt Next.js projekt för att komma igång. Next.js tillhandahåller ett kommando för att skapa projekt för att hjälpa dig kickstarta snabbt. Öppna ett kommandoradsfönster och kör följande kommando:

npx create-next-app my-nextjs-app

Var my-nextjs-app är namnet på ditt projekt. Ovanstående kommando kommer att skapa en ny katalog som innehåller Next.js projektet och installera nödvändiga beroenden.

Steg 3: Kör Next.js programmet

När projektet har skapats framgångsrikt kan du navigera in i projektkatalogen och starta Next.js programmet

genom att köra kommandot:

cd my-nextjs-app  
npm run dev  

Din applikation kommer att köras på standardporten 3000. Du kan öppna en webbläsare och komma åt adressen http://localhost:3000 för att se den applikation som körs.

 

Fortsätt din inlärningsresa och utforska Next.js genom denna spännande artikelserie. I de kommande artiklarna kommer vi att fördjupa oss i olika aspekter av Next.js och bygga vackra dynamiska webbapplikationer!